WhiteFiber Announces Closing of Upsized $310.0 Million Convertible Senior Notes Offering

WhiteFiber, Inc. (WYFI) closed a $310.0 million convertible senior notes offering, including an additional $40.0 million from an option. The notes have a 5.00% interest rate and mature in 2032. The company received $298.5 million in net proceeds, using $118.5 million to pay for existing notes and the rest for data center expansion, acquisitions, and general corporate purposes. WhiteFiber closes $310m convertible notes offering

WhiteFiber, Inc. (NASDAQ:WYFI) closed a $310.0 million convertible notes offering, with net proceeds of $298.5 million. The company used $118.5 million to exchange existing notes for cash and shares, and plans to use the rest for data center expansion and other purposes. The notes have a 5.00% interest rate and a conversion price of $33.84 per share, a 25% premium over the company’s share price on August 18, 2026.
